Well there will be no need for that! Let's not get too hasty! You can activate a Verizon phone that you buy off ebay, providing that it's not very old and is E911 capable for starters.

But I caution you to try and stick with phones that already have the ESN listed on the auction (or write to the seller and ask). You can call into VZW and ask a representative to check this electronic serial number in the system and we can find out if this is on the lost or stolen list BEFORE you buy it.

If you bring us a phone that is on this stolen list, we will refuse to activate it. You may want to see if any trusted friends have an old phone they are lookiing to get rid of too. This usually cuts down on your chances for fraud.

And when you're speaking with a representative, why don't you ask what your upgrade options are now? We may have an early or annual upgrade you can take advantage of, depending on your price plan and how long ago you upgraded to the phone you have now. Plus there's always the option of buying a phone at full price. Since breaking a contract is $175, we can set you up nicely with a phone @ full retail price for about that much anyway and that way you can stick with VZW.
